Frequently Asked Questions

1

What is CVE-2023-32391?

CVE-2023-32391 is a vulnerability that allows a shortcut to use sensitive data without prompting the user.

2

What software versions are affected by CVE-2023-32391?

iOS versions up to but excluding 15.7.6, iPadOS versions up to but excluding 15.7.6, watchOS up to but excluding 9.5, macOS Ventura up to but excluding 13.4, iOS versions up to but excluding 16.5, and iPadOS versions up to but excluding 16.5 are affected by CVE-2023-32391.

3

What is the severity of CVE-2023-32391?

The severity of CVE-2023-32391 is medium, with a severity score of 4.6.

4

How was CVE-2023-32391 addressed?

CVE-2023-32391 was addressed with improved checks in iOS 15.7.6 and iPadOS 15.7.6, watchOS 9.5, iOS 16.5 and iPadOS 16.5, and macOS Ventura 13.4.
